The short version
With 6,112 people, North Manchester is a city in Indiana. The typical home is worth $87,600. 5% of locals were born outside the United States. Getting to work takes 19 minutes on average. Renters pay $606 a month at the median. About 23% of adults have finished a four-year degree.

Frequently asked
How many people live in North Manchester, Indiana? North Manchester, Indiana has about 6,112 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in North Manchester, Indiana? The typical household in North Manchester, Indiana earns about $41,088 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is North Manchester, Indiana expensive? In North Manchester, Indiana, the median home is worth about $87,600, and the typical rent is about $606 a month.
How educated are people in North Manchester, Indiana? About 23.0% of adults age 25 and over in North Manchester, Indiana h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in North Manchester, Indiana? About 14.9% of people in North Manchester, Indiana live below the federal poverty line.
